// Example how to write an async http client using the modified standard client.
|
|
const AsyncClient = struct {
|
|
cli: Client,
|
|
|
|
const YieldImpl = Loop.Yield(AsyncRequest);
|
|
const AsyncRequest = struct {
|
|
const State = enum { new, open, send, finish, wait, done };
|
|
|
|
cli: *Client,
|
|
uri: std.Uri,
|
|
|
|
req: ?Request = undefined,
|
|
state: State = .new,
|
|
|
|
impl: YieldImpl,
|
|
err: ?anyerror = null,
|
|
|
|
buf: [2014]u8 = undefined,
|
|
|
|
pub fn deinit(self: *AsyncRequest) void {
|
|
if (self.req) |*r| r.deinit();
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
pub fn fetch(self: *AsyncRequest) void {
|
|
self.state = .new;
|
|
return self.impl.yield(self);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
fn onerr(self: *AsyncRequest, err: anyerror) void {
|
|
self.state = .done;
|
|
self.err = err;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
pub fn onYield(self: *AsyncRequest, err: ?anyerror) void {
|
|
if (err) |e| return self.onerr(e);
|
|
|
|
switch (self.state) {
|
|
.new => {
|
|
self.state = .open;
|
|
self.req = self.cli.open(.GET, self.uri, .{
|
|
.server_header_buffer = &self.buf,
|
|
}) catch |e| return self.onerr(e);
|
|
},
|
|
.open => {
|
|
self.state = .send;
|
|
self.req.?.send() catch |e| return self.onerr(e);
|
|
},
|
|
.send => {
|
|
self.state = .finish;
|
|
self.req.?.finish() catch |e| return self.onerr(e);
|
|
},
|
|
.finish => {
|
|
self.state = .wait;
|
|
self.req.?.wait() catch |e| return self.onerr(e);
|
|
},
|
|
.wait => {
|
|
self.state = .done;
|
|
return;
|
|
},
|
|
.done => return,
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
return self.impl.yield(self);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
pub fn wait(self: *AsyncRequest) !void {
|
|
while (self.state != .done) try self.impl.tick();
|
|
if (self.err) |err| return err;
|
|
}
|
|
};
|
|
|
|
pub fn init(alloc: std.mem.Allocator, loop: *Loop) AsyncClient {
|
|
return .{
|
|
.cli = .{
|
|
.allocator = alloc,
|
|
.loop = loop,
|
|
},
|
|
};
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
pub fn deinit(self: *AsyncClient) void {
|
|
self.cli.deinit();
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
pub fn createRequest(self: *AsyncClient, uri: std.Uri) !AsyncRequest {
|
|
return .{
|
|
.impl = YieldImpl.init(self.cli.loop),
|
|
.cli = &self.cli,
|
|
.uri = uri,
|
|
};
|
|
}
|
|
};
